Eat at a calorie deficit. Find some kind of exercise that you enjoy and stick with it.
Since you don't have a huge amount of weight to lose, I recommend that you set your weight loss goal at 1, or maybe even .5 lbs per week. Sure, it might seem slower, but you're more likely to stick with what you're doing and sustain loss in the long term.
Eat back your exercise calories! However, be aware that the general consensus is that MFP overestimates calorie burns. So, if you don't have a better way of tracking your exercise burns, what I have done is only record about 3/4 of the time of the exercise that I do.
